Well, if those plants were in an inground vegetable garden I would have to say that they are suffering from a micro-nutrient deficiency with possibly a touch of some fungal disease and I would use liquid iron chelate on them and then I would spray with Neem Oil, but since they are not, I don't know what's wrong or how to fix it.
